Also valvers have an Auxilary fuel tank Patrick. Sits on the right of the spare wheel. In the event of running out of fuel it pumps the auxilary fuel into the main tank! Genius!
 
yep if you let the fuel light come on thats when the pump works. tiny little pump looks a bit like a washer pump fastened near the little reserve tank.
